Question 1 of 5

Where does sperm maturation take place in the male reproductive system?

Correct Answer: C

Rationale: The correct answer is C, Epididymis. Sperm maturation occurs in the epididymis, a coiled tube located on the back of each testicle. Here, sperm gain motility and the ability to fertilize an egg. Seminal vesicles (A) and prostate gland (B) produce fluids that combine with sperm to form semen but do not play a role in sperm maturation. Vas deferens (D) is a tube that carries mature sperm from the epididymis to the urethra but is not the site of sperm maturation.

Question 2 of 5

Which of the following are the reproductive cells produced by meiosis?

Correct Answer: D

Rationale: The correct answer is D: Gametes. Meiosis is a type of cell division that produces gametes (sperm and egg cells) with half the number of chromosomes as the parent cell. Genes (A) are units of heredity, alleles (B) are different forms of a gene, and chromatids (C) are duplicated chromosomes. These choices are not directly produced by meiosis but are related to genetic material and cell division processes. Gametes are the specific reproductive cells formed through meiosis, making them the correct answer.

Question 4 of 5

What do nociceptors detect?

Correct Answer: C

Rationale: Nociceptors detect pain. They are specialized nerve endings that respond to potentially harmful stimuli. When activated, nociceptors send signals to the brain, resulting in the sensation of pain. Deep pressure (A) and vibration (B) are detected by other types of receptors, while temperature (D) is detected by thermoreceptors. Therefore, the correct answer is C because nociceptors specifically respond to pain stimuli.

Question 5 of 5

What makes bone resistant to shattering?

Correct Answer: D

Rationale: The correct answer is D because bones are resistant to shattering due to the intricate balance of minerals like calcium and phosphorus, along with collagen fibers. Calcium salts alone (choice A) only provide hardness, not flexibility. Collagen fibers (choice B) provide strength but not hardness. Bone marrow and blood vessels (choice C) support bone health but don't contribute directly to resistance to shattering. The combination of minerals and collagen fibers in choice D provides both hardness and flexibility, making bones resistant to shattering.
